Soil structure — where it appears

The two-way interaction between a structure and the ground it sits in. The ground's stiffness changes the structure's response, and the structure's stiffness changes what the ground delivers. It lengthens a building's period, adds radiation damping, and decides how much of an imposed ground deformation a buried structure actually receives.
